Output 06d20760622d62fde39760e52ce914910745f344e134c745f10ea2ed81c1f7b5:1

value
633489457
script pubkey
OP_0 OP_PUSHBYTES_20 0d520fb6b653994d5c73e265e66a3329b7005ac2
address
ltc1qp4fqld4k2wv56hrnufj7v63n9xmsqkkz6upxqh
transaction
06d20760622d62fde39760e52ce914910745f344e134c745f10ea2ed81c1f7b5
spent
true